Rosamary is a girl's name of American origin. Blending Rosa (rose) with Mary, Rosamary creates a botanical-spiritual harmony: the rose representing love and beauty, Mary representing maternal grace and devotion. This combination, less common than its variants Rosamaria or Rosamarie, offers a more subtle, musical form that bridges Spanish/Italian roots with English sensibility. It conveys both nature and spirituality.
A less common variant that bridges Romance language and English naming traditions.
